/// Builds the Code 128 input string, choosing the most compact character set.
|
||||
///
|
||||
/// Code 128 set C packs two digits per symbol, so numeric data renders roughly
|
||||
/// half as wide as set B (one character per symbol). Google Wallet (via ZXing)
|
||||
/// picks set C automatically for numeric runs, so we do the same to keep the
|
||||
/// rendered barcode compact and consistent with it:
|
||||
///
|
||||
/// - Even-length digit-only numbers: all set C (`Ć` prefix).
|
||||
/// - Odd-length digit-only numbers: first digit in set B, then switch to set C
|
||||
/// for the remaining even count of digits (e.g. `Ɓ6Ć0171...`).
|
||||
/// - Anything else: set B (`Ɓ` prefix).
|
||||
fn code128_input(number: &str) -> String {
|
||||
let is_all_digits = !number.is_empty() && number.chars().all(|c| c.is_ascii_digit());
|
||||
if !is_all_digits {
|
||||
return format!("Ɓ{number}");
|
||||
}
|
||||
let len = number.chars().count();
|
||||
if len % 2 == 0 {
|
||||
format!("Ć{number}")
|
||||
} else {
|
||||
let (first, rest) = number.split_at(1);
|
||||
format!("Ɓ{first}Ć{rest}")
|
||||
}
|
||||
}
